Precision Unleashed: The Pixart 3950 Optical Sensor
At the core of the SCYROX V6's performance lies the Pixart 3950 optical sensor, specified with impressive metrics: 750 Inches Per Second (IPS) maximum speed, up to 30,000 Dots Per Inch (DPI), and 50g acceleration. These are top-tier specifications.
These figures indicate the sensor's capability to track exceptionally fast movements without losing fidelity or spinning out. A high IPS rating ensures that even the most aggressive swipes are registered accurately. The 30K DPI offers extreme sensitivity, though most users will operate at much lower settings.
Compared to entry-level sensors that might offer 200-300 IPS and 10,000 DPI, the Pixart 3950 provides a substantial upgrade in raw tracking power. This sensor ensures consistent and reliable performance across various surfaces, making it suitable for professional esports environments.
The Polling Rate Advantage: 8KHz Wireless
The SCYROX V6 boasts an 8KHz wireless polling rate, a specification that signifies the mouse reports its position to the computer 8,000 times per second. This is remarkably fast.
An 8KHz polling rate drastically reduces input latency, making mouse movements and clicks feel almost instantaneous. This level of responsiveness provides a competitive edge in games where reaction time is paramount. Every input is registered swiftly.
While 1000Hz (1KHz) polling rate is standard for high-performance gaming mice, 8KHz represents an eightfold increase in reporting frequency. This advanced capability minimizes the delay between physical movement and on-screen action, a difference often perceptible to seasoned gamers.

Connectivity and System Demands
As a wireless mouse, the SCYROX V6 offers freedom from cable drag, a significant advantage in competitive play. The wireless receiver is critical.
Wireless technology has advanced to a point where latency is virtually indistinguishable from wired connections, especially with an 8KHz polling rate. This allows for unrestricted movement across the mousepad, vital for dynamic gameplay. No more tangled wires.
However, it's important to note that an 8KHz polling rate can be demanding on system resources. Users with older or lower-spec PCs might experience performance issues. A modern CPU is recommended to fully utilize this feature without introducing system lag. This is a trade-off for speed.
